I've spent little over two weeks at The Inn of the Golden Crab and give it high marks.

It is not a hotel, but rather apartments. One bedroom apartments are 1,000 Baht a day (Low Season) and you can add 100 THB to that if you want your unit cleaned and linen changed daily.

 

Monthly Rates (as of 10 August 2006):

1 bedroom B20,000 p.m. Low Season, B23,000 p.m. High Season.

2 bedroom B26,000 p.m. Low Season, B29,000 p.m. High Season

 

The apartment has a kitchen with a two burner cook-top, full cabinetry, counter space, refrig. and all the tableware and cookware you might need.

The floors are very attractive marble tile throughout the apartment.

The bed is perfectly adequate for 2, but too small for 3, so if you are into all night threesomes you might not find it comfortable.

The bathroom has a shower, walk-in type separated from the loo by a 4 foot tall by 6 inch thick partition. Nicely done for that type of bathroom design.

The in room safe is the best I've seen to date, but, unfortunately, not the biggest. You can have a 7 digit number plus a letter combination making it nearly impossible for someone to "crack" your code. Plus, you only have to enter the code once to open the safe. To lock it, just close the door and turn the knob counterclockwise.

If I could change anything I would add a couch (sofa) in the living room. As it is the two chairs and the coffee table give what is otherwise a very attractive room a "cold, unfinished" feeling.

Each apartment has a balcony large enough for a table and two chairs looking toward the east and over the pool.

There is a car park under the new wing, but at ground level, and, of course, a lift.

The new wing is completed and I understand the owner has shut down the old wing and is refurbishing each apartment so they match the new wing.

As it is not a hotel there is no food service, but La Maison is next door, The Haven is just across the street and The Sportsman is across the street and just to the left of The Sandy Spring.

While it is not the Marriott, it is a great location and I would stay there again.

INN OF THE GOLDEN CRAB

SERVICED APARTMENTS 100M FROM THE CENTER OF PATTAYA BEACH

 

Welcome to the Golden Crab. We hope you decide to stay with us for your next visit. This information sheet is designed to provide answers to questions you may have about the facilities. We hope you find it useful and informative.

 

The complex contains twenty six one bedroom apartments, and nine two bedroom ones. All have air conditioning & ceiling fans with hot & cold water. There is a small swimming pool, and a bar.

 

There are books in many languages in our library next to the lift on floor 2. All apartments have cable TV showing around sixty channels in many languages 24 hours a day.

 

Each apartment has a small kitchen, with a two ring hob and refrigerator. All pots, crocks, etc. are provided, and there is an electronic safe fitted. Each has a separate living room with dining area. All bedrooms have double beds and en-suite shower room and toilet. Bed linen and towels are provided and these are changed, and the apartments are cleaned, every three days. There is no additional charge for this service. Please note that we do NOT provide toilet rolls, soap, etc. free.
